Software Engineer - Core Marketing Platforms

Summary

Builds and optimizes Java-based microservices for real-time customer communications and promotions, focusing on scalable event-driven systems and on-call support in a gambling tech environment.

You will build and optimize high-performance microservices for real-time customer communications, personalized promotions, and targeted campaigns. You will design scalable event-driven systems, write secure and maintainable Java code, contribute to technical decisions, troubleshoot issues, document software, and participate in on-call support.
